The Industrial Machine Mechanic III is a senior-level technical expert responsible for advanced diagnostics, complex mechanical repairs, and major CNC machine tool rebuilds. This role requires deep expertise in precision machine systems, the ability to independently manage large-scale service projects, and a strong commitment to quality and safety standards.
The ideal candidate brings extensive hands-on experience with CNC machine tools, advanced troubleshooting capabilities, and the ability to coordinate installations and rebuilds from start to finish. This position requires frequent travel, the ability to work independently with minimal supervision, and collaboration with customers, OEMs, vendors, and internal teams.
Key Responsibilities
· Serve as the subject matter expert for complex mechanical and machine tool issues
· Perform major machine tool rebuilds, reconditioning, and precision fitting
· Conduct advanced diagnostics on mechanical and electrical systems
· Troubleshoot and repair machine tool components, including electronic circuitry to the component level
· Dismantle, rebuild, and reassemble machine tool subassemblies and complete systems
· Perform precision alignment, leveling, scraping, and mechanical adjustments
· Organize, tag, and document machine components for accurate reassembly
· Identify, repair, or replace damaged mechanical and electrical components
· Coordinate and complete full machine installations
· Independently plan, organize, and execute complex service calls and rebuild projects
· Train, mentor, and support lower-level mechanics and technicians
· Collaborate with customers, OEMs, vendors, and internal personnel to resolve technical issues
· Maintain accurate service reports and expense documentation
· Ensure all work meets company quality and safety standards
· Maintain a clean, safe, and organized work environment
· Travel to customer facilities with limited notice
· Perform additional duties as assigned

KRC is a truly unique company in the machine tool industry. Founded in 1989 by Thomas Luzak, an industrial engineer with an MBA from Syracuse University, the company fosters a strong work ethic by practicing open-book management with significant profit sharing for all employees.
As the company grew, additional space was required. In 1997, KRC expanded its state-of-the-art facility to 35,000 square feet, complete with high bays, heavy floors, 15 ton, and 20 ton overhead cranes, machining capabilities, and steam cleaning and paint booths.
In 2019, KRC announced a company-wide rebranding initiative. KRC Machine Tool Services, has changed to KRC Machine Tool Solutions. This milestone ushers in a new era in the history of our 30 years. The rebranding is designed to better reflect our expanded range of capabilities as we continue our efforts to be the complete machine tool solutions company.
As part of the rebrand, KRC Machine Tool Solutions expanded capabilities to include multiple new product category offerings. Included in the expansion is the production of our own private label machine lines, ushering in the next generation of American-made precision machine tools. These product lines will include large and medium format gantry style machines and vertical turning lathes ranging in various sizes and configurations.
KRC continues to grow, and currently employs just under 100 people. KRC is still known as the premier provider in CNC retrofitting, machine rebuilding, and machine tool repair serving all key industrial markets. Our nationwide team of service engineers performs repairs and troubleshooting, preventive maintenance and laser alignments at the customer's facility.
